For real though, if you stipulate that there are something like 70-80 FBS programs that are relevant on some level at least equivalent to the bottom 5 franchises in each of the NFL/NBA/NHL/MLB, then a 24 team playoff with 8 byes makes a lot of sense. Pro sports all include almost half the league in their playoffs. Seems fair to have the top 25-33% make it, and to have the top 10% get byes and the next 15-20% have to win a play in to get to the main bracket. So it preserves rewards/advantages for the very best teams, and admits enough teams that the first teams cut will be mediocre 3+ loss teams that didn’t beat anyone good.
